Herb: Pale Spring Beauty


Latin name: Montia spathulata


Synonyms: Claytonia exigua


Family: Portulacaceae (Purslane Family)



Edible parts of Pale Spring Beauty:

Leaves - raw or cooked. Succulent.

Description of the plant:



Plant:
Annual


Height:
8 cm
(3 1/4 inch)

Habitat of the herb:

Dry to moist slopes.

Propagation of Pale Spring Beauty:

Seed - sow spring or autumn in situ. The seed usually germinates rapidly.
